Open-Mic Night Every Wednesday Evening at Art’s Place, located at milepost 2.5 on the Beach Road. Art’s Place provides the most laid- back, personal setting for you to Embrace your Stardom. Play with the host band on back-up or be the center of attention. We also provide a variety of instruments if needed. Sit back, have a beer and a burger and be a part of the best local entertainment Wednesday Nites on the OBX has to Offer! Open-Mic starts at 7pm until ? Phone: 252.261.3233 -

Arts Place presents the incomparable Joe Mapp and the Coordinates. Joe Mapp on guitar, Mick Vaughn on bass guitar and Dan Martier on drums provide a musical path to enlightenment anyone Monday night on the outer banks in January. It is impossible to get any closer to the music than at Arts, Intimacy at the smallest and one of the oldest icons left on the outer banks can’t be helped. Fusion jazz and more … as always, No cover and as always the best burger & fries, according to Our State Magazine, anywhere on the outer banks. Come listen, come eat. Located on the Beach Road (MP 2.5) in Kitty Hawk. 252-261-3233 -

The BIG Something is an ever-evolving, groove-based modern rock band from the middle of nowhere in NC. With unique electronic embellishments and an alternative feel, Funk, Soul and Rock n Roll are all fused into “one savory package, well delivered in execution. This Friday (December 9) starting at 10pm, they will take the stage at the Outer Banks Brewing Station. More info HERE

Old school Punk band from Orange County, CA blends punk rock with surf music. The result: just about every surfer/skater used this music to get the adrenaline flowing before a session. I know I did. Pay some respect to this pioneering band that led the way for many to follow. Their live show is highly energetic… even to this day (over 3 decades later). They are scheduled to play the Port O’ Call in Kill Devil Hills, NC, this Friday night, Sept. 23, 2011. Show starts at 10pm. $20.
